About Damehra Village
Damehra is a village in Bharari tehsil in district of Bilaspur, Chhattisgarh, India. As per the data provided by Census of India in 2011, total population of Damehra was 178 which includes 92 males and 86 females. Damehra covers 31.07 ha area. Pincode of Damehra is 174028.
